The second half of life isn't about reaching a certain age or even "getting old." According to James Hollis, it is a pivotal time of rebirth when we stop living out the expectations of others--and start answering our soul's true calling. With Through the Dark Wood, this Jungian analyst and master storyteller provides an invaluable guide for listeners facing the challenges of midlife. Invoking a rich combination of mythology, poetry, and psychological insights, Hollis invites listeners to discover how the so-called "crisis" of midlife is actually a unique opportunity to grow out of the illusions of youth, develop true spiritual maturity, and live up to the greatness of your soul's desire.
